What affects the price

Installing a new HVAC system involves several variables that shift the final total. The square footage of your home and the necessary cooling capacity—measured in tons—are the biggest factors. You also have to consider the efficiency rating of the unit, the complexity of your existing ductwork, and whether you need to upgrade electrical or gas lines to accommodate the new equipment. Replacing both a furnace and an AC at the same time often makes sense to ensure system compatibility and energy efficiency. The total cost is influenced by the fuel type, equipment efficiency, and whether any modifications are needed for the venting or ductwork.
